Duties and responsibilities

Successful candidates will be trained and later responsible for:

  • Enforcing Road Traffic, Public Passenger, and Transport Legislation.
  • Conducting roadblocks, point duty, and traffic control.
  • Safeguarding accident scenes and identifying hazardous road locations.
  • Conducting speed testing operations and issuing notices.
  • Escorting abnormal loads and monitoring overload control.
  • Examining drivers’ licences and vehicles at Driver Licence Testing Centres (DLTCs) and Vehicle Testing Stations (VTSs).
  • Assisting in crime prevention activities and road safety operations.
  • Performing administrative duties in line with RTI operational plans.
